What You'll Do
As the Crisis Intervention Specialist, you will respond to staff calls for assistance or support to behavioral events. You will help individuals who struggle with a variety of behavioral challenges including intellectual disabilities, autism spectrum disorder, generalized anxiety disorder and drama/stressor related symptomology. You will work under the guidance of the Behavioral Intervention Specialists to provide in-the-moment training of intervention strategies and plans and collaborate with the Behavioral Intervention Specialists to carry out treatment plans for individuals and assist with day-to-day tasks to ensure health and well-being.
Your responsibilities will include:
+ Responding to crises when a crisis or warning signs of a crisis are noted by other providers
+ Working to de-escalate individuals in crisis, providing emotional support and assistance to help them regain control of their behavior
+ Providing practical assistance and resources to help individuals manage their crisis
+ Effectively using verbal and non-verbal communication skills and behavior support techniques to help manage aggressive behavior and defuse students in crisis
+ Collaborating with other staff members, including therapists, nurses and other professionals, to ensure comprehensive care
+ Helping in assessing the nature and severity of crises
+ Assisting staff in completing thorough documentation of behaviors as needed.
+ Working collaboratively with team members to effectively support all students in program assignments
+ Attending training sessions to keep current on behavior management.
+ Supporting behavioral team with training staff on techniques to support student behaviors
+ Attending team meetings when necessary
+ Other duties as assigned by Supervisor

Who We Are
The mission of Easterseals New York is to spread help, hope and answers.
We operate programs that enable people with special needs to achieve equality, dignity and independence in their own communities. We provide exceptional services to ensure that people with disabilities or special needs and their families have equal opportunities to live, learn, work and play in their communities. We change the way the world defines and views disabilities by making profound, positive differences in people’s lives every day.
Easterseals New York joined The Fedcap Group in 2015.
